    Joan Lasenby on Applications of Geometric Algebra in Engineering

    Joan Lasenby, Craig Cannon, Mark Mandelmann, Carrie Nordlund

    A joint project between the Engineering and Architecture departments at Cambridge utilizes Geometric Algebra to enable drones to reconstruct the built environment through line-based computer vision, overcoming the limitations of traditional point-cloud methods. By leveraging this mathematical framework to unify scalars, vectors, and higher-dimensional primitives, the researchers facilitate coordinate-free motion extraction and sensor fusion for complex robotic tasks. While the approach prioritizes developer productivity and geometric clarity over raw computational speed, it faces adoption barriers due to its steep learning curve despite surging interest from younger engineers.
